为什么现代企业需要重新审视虚拟主机管理方案?
在数字化转型加速的2025年,企业对网站托管的需求已从“能用”升级为“高效、安全、易扩展”。传统的单服务器托管模式暴露出资源分配不均、管理复杂等问题,而基于Apache的虚拟主机管理系统正成为破局关键。它通过灵活的配置和集中化管理,为企业提供低成本、高可用的网站托管解决方案。
Apache虚拟主机的核心优势
1. 资源隔离与高效利用
Apache的虚拟主机技术(基于NameVirtualHost或IP-based)允许多个域名共享同一台服务器资源,而彼此独立运行。例如:
- IP-based虚拟主机:适合需要独立IP的高安全性场景;
- Name-based虚拟主机:通过域名区分站点,节省IP成本。
操作示例:在httpd.conf
中配置Name-based虚拟主机:
apache复制<VirtualHost *:80>
ServerName www.example.com
DocumentRoot /var/www/example
VirtualHost>
2. 动态扩展能力
通过模块如mod_rewrite
和mod_proxy
,Apache可轻松实现负载均衡和反向代理,应对流量激增。例如,将请求分发到后端多台应用服务器:
apache复制ProxyPass "/app" "http://backend-server/"
配置与管理的关键步骤
1. 安全加固策略
- 禁用不必要模块:减少攻击面,如
mod_php
替换为PHP-FPM; - SSL/TLS强制加密:使用Let’s Encrypt免费证书,配置
mod_ssl
:apache复制
SSLEngine On SSLCertificateFile /path/to/cert.pem
2. 性能优化技巧
- 启用缓存:通过
mod_cache
减少数据库压力; - 压缩传输内容:
mod_deflate
可降低带宽消耗30%以上。
与传统方案的对比
对比维度 | Apache虚拟主机 | 传统独立服务器 |
---|---|---|
成本 | 低(共享资源) | 高(独占硬件) |
管理复杂度 | 中(需配置技能) | 高(全栈维护) |
适用场景 | 中小网站、测试环境 | 高流量、合规需求 |
未来趋势:容器化与Apache的融合
2025年,越来越多的企业将Apache与Docker/Kubernetes结合,实现更轻量的虚拟化。例如:
- 容器化Apache:快速部署、版本回滚;
- 微服务架构:通过
mod_proxy
将请求路由到不同容器服务。
个人观点:Apache或许不是最新技术,但其稳定性和灵活性在混合云时代仍不可替代。关键在于合理配置,而非盲目追求“最新”。
独家数据:据2025年Web服务器调查报告,Apache仍占据全球34%的市场份额,尤其在中小企业中,其易用性和社区支持是主要竞争力。